单元测试,这是软件开发中一个老生常谈的话题。有些人认为单元测试能够提高代码质量,保证程序的稳定性,而另一些人却认为它是有害的。今天我们就来谈谈这个备受争议的话题。

首先,让我们看看单元测试为什么被认为是有害的。有人认为,编写单元测试会消耗大量的时间和精力,而且它们并不能完全覆盖所有可能的情况。此外,如果测试用例过于复杂,还会增加维护成本,让代码变得难以理解和修改。

然而,正如每个硬币都有两面一样,单元测试也有它的好处。它可以帮助我们发现潜在的bug,并确保修改代码后不会引入新的问题。此外,单元测试还可以提高代码的可读性,让我们更好地理解和维护代码。

所以,单元测试究竟是有害的还是有益的?这个问题没有一个标准答案,取决于你的具体情况。如果你的项目规模很小,且时间紧迫,也许可以暂时放下单元测试;但如果你的项目很大,且需要长期维护,那么单元测试可能是必不可少的。

无论你选择怎么做,都不要盲目跟风,应该根据具体情况做出明智的决定。最重要的是,要始终保持代码整洁和可维护,这才是我们编程的终极目标。

详情参考

了解更多有趣的事情:https://blog.ds3783.com/